Use the Discover and Add External Catalogs dialog box in System Center Updates Publisher to retrieve the list of all partner catalogs that have been registered with Microsoft and to add the catalogs to the import list. The dialog box is opened from the Import tab in the Settings dialog box by clicking Find.
This dialog box contains the following elements:
- External Catalog(s)
- Displays a list of vendor software updates catalogs that have
been registered with Microsoft and not already imported to Updates
Publisher. This list is retrieved from an external Web site and
therefore requires an Internet connection.
Note
Updates Publisher 4.5 provides a proxy server credentials dialog box when the connection fails for the current user. When this dialog box displays, enter the proxy server name, port, and the user name and password for an account that has appropriate proxy server permissions.
- Add >
- Adds the highlighted software updates catalog from the External Catalogs section to the Chosen catalog(s) section.
- Add All
- Adds all software updates catalogs from the External Catalogs section to the Chosen catalog(s) section.
- < Remove
- Removes the highlighted software updates catalog from the Chosen catalog(s) section to the External Catalogs section.
- Remove All
- Removes all software updates catalogs from the Chosen catalog(s) section to the External Catalogs section.
- Chosen catalog(s)
- Displays a list of the vendor software updates catalogs that have been added from the External Catalog section. The catalogs in the Chosen catalog(s) section will be added to the Import List on the Import List tab in the Settings dialog box.
- Catalog Details
- Displays the following information about the highlighted
catalog:
- URL: The import path for the
catalog.
- Support: The path where support
information is available for the catalog.
- Description: The description for the
catalog.

- OK
- Saves the changes and returns to the Settings dialog box.
- Cancel
- Exits the dialog box without saving any changes and returns to the Settings dialog box.
